Tune Transmision

I was thinking of getting an X3 Tuner for my 01 4.2 5spd for a while now, but was curious of what kind of transmission your guys have, auto or stick? and the tuner you guys are using, and can you really feel the difference with a manual trans?

There will be more of a difference with an automatic since Ford tunes these automatics so "soft" because they have to tune them so that the majority of the population will like it. Not everyone likes stiff shifting. Regardless a tune for a manual vehicle will make a big difference. It was the first mod I did to my car and it made a big difference. Adding a CAI and tune made it like a whole new car. So my suggestion is to get both at the same time so the tuner can tune for the intake so you're not running lean and your A/Fs are good.
